Original Charmed Ones Cast and Roles

The original 1998 series cast the Halliwell sisters as the Charmed Ones, with Shannen Doherty as Prue, Holly Marie Combs as Piper, Alyssa Milano as Phoebe, and later Rose McGowan as Paige. The show ran for eight seasons on The WB and UPN, ending in 2006, and became a defining supernatural drama for its time original series data.

The core premise centered on three sisters discovering they were witches, with the line-up shifting when Doherty left and McGowan joined. The series was produced by Spelling Television and aired more than 170 episodes, establishing a loyal global fanbase and syndication presence on channels such as ABC Family and Syfy.
